Software Development Tools

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son
Download our mobile app to listen on the go
Get App

Questions and Answers

What does the company promise to do with every piece of feedback received?

  • Store it without reviewing
  • Ignore it
  • Delete it
  • Read it very seriously (correct)

What is encouraged by the company for writing better code?

  • Utilizing AI (correct)
  • Avoiding finding and fixing vulnerabilities
  • Collaborating outside of code
  • Using outdated practices

When should you reload to refresh your session according to the text?

  • When you can't perform an action at that time (correct)
  • When you switch accounts
  • After finding and fixing vulnerabilities
  • After signing in

What is a key benefit of collaborating outside of code as mentioned in the text?

<p>Improved collaboration (D)</p> Signup and view all the answers

What should be done to see all available qualifiers according to the text?

<p>Refer to the documentation (D)</p> Signup and view all the answers

Какая методология программирования основана на представлении программы в виде совокупности объектов?

<p>Объектно-ориентированное программирование (A)</p> Signup and view all the answers

Что является основным логическим конструктивным элементом в объектно-ориентированном программировании?

<p>Объекты (B)</p> Signup and view all the answers

Какие элементы образуют иерархию наследования в объектно-ориентированном программировании?

<p>Классы (D)</p> Signup and view all the answers

Что называется не объектно-ориентированным программированием?

<p>Программирование без наследования (B)</p> Signup and view all the answers

Что является основным принципом объектно-ориентированного программирования?

<p>Абстракция данных и методов (C)</p> Signup and view all the answers

Что является признаком объектно-ориентированной программы?

<p>Использование объектов и выполнение трех определенных требований (B)</p> Signup and view all the answers

Что превращает поступательное движение поршня во вращательное движение колёс?

<p>Коленвал (B)</p> Signup and view all the answers

Что позволяет пользователям крутить руль и нажимать на педаль газа, не задумываясь о внутренних процессах?

<p>Прогресс (D)</p> Signup and view all the answers

Что обеспечивает поворот колёс на различающиеся углы?

<p>Дифференциалы (B)</p> Signup and view all the answers

Что превращает поступательное движение поршня во вращательное движение колёс?

<p>Распредвал (C)</p> Signup and view all the answers

Какие элементы ответственны за поставку бензина в двигатель?

<p>Дифференциалы (A)</p> Signup and view all the answers

Какие элементы являются основными логическими конструктивными элементами в объектно-ориентированном программировании?

<p>Объекты (D)</p> Signup and view all the answers

Что является основным отличительным признаком объектно-ориентированного программирования?

<p>Использование объектов (A)</p> Signup and view all the answers

Что представляет собой каждый объект в объектно-ориентированном программировании?

<p>Экземпляр определенного класса (D)</p> Signup and view all the answers

Что необходимо для того, чтобы программа была считалась объектно-ориентированной по методологии ООП?

<p>Наличие наследования и абстрактных типов данных (D)</p> Signup and view all the answers

Что является ошибочным утверждением относительно ООП?

<p>ООП использует только алгоритмы, а не объекты (D)</p> Signup and view all the answers

Что отличает объектно-ориентированное программирование от программирования с помощью абстрактных типов данных?

<p>Наличие наследования и классов (B)</p> Signup and view all the answers

Что представляет собой инкапсуляция в объектно-ориентированном программировании?

<p>Свойство системы, скрывающее детали реализации класса (B)</p> Signup and view all the answers

Что обеспечивает принцип наследования в объектно-ориентированном программировании?

<p>Создание новой сущности на базе уже существующей (C)</p> Signup and view all the answers

Что означает абстракция в контексте объектно-ориентированного программирования?

<p>Набор общих характеристик (D)</p> Signup and view all the answers

Что подразумевается под полиморфизмом в объектно-ориентированном программировании?

<p>Иметь разные формы для одной и той же сущности (B)</p> Signup and view all the answers

Чем отличается посылка сообщений в объектно-ориентированном программировании от инкапсуляции?

<p>Способом изменения состояния объекта (C)</p> Signup and view all the answers

Что означает переиспользование в контексте объектно-ориентированного программирования?

<p>Возможность использовать код повторно (C)</p> Signup and view all the answers

Чем полиморфизм отличается от абстракции в ООП?

<p>В возможности иметь разные формы для одной и той же сущности (C)</p> Signup and view all the answers

Какая концепция ООП отвечает за создание новых сущностей на основе уже существующих?

<p><strong>Наследование</strong> (C)</p> Signup and view all the answers

Чем отличается посылка сообщений от переиспользования в объектно-ориентированном программировании?

<p><strong>Способом изменения состояния объекта</strong> (B)</p> Signup and view all the answers

Flashcards are hidden until you start studying

More Like This

GitHub Features and Tools Quiz
3 questions
Java Packages Overview
5 questions
Python Unit 5: Modules and Packages
55 questions
Use Quizgecko on...
Browser
Browser